Output 2aba3d8d2c268b9242aa693ca3f2c9bc4c98cab75211945dd4d7ffb75580608e:17

value
2894339
script pubkey
OP_0 OP_PUSHBYTES_20 bc5984ac18f803007518e1ef53b6a401703cb354
address
ltc1qh3vcftqclqpsqagcu8h48d4yq9crev65k7f07k
transaction
2aba3d8d2c268b9242aa693ca3f2c9bc4c98cab75211945dd4d7ffb75580608e
spent
true